Ticket #—: Vault locked, ORM refactor blocked

Priority: high. The Quillbase migration vault auto-locked after three failed schema pushes during the legacy ORM refactor. Until it's unsealed, no mapping changes for the `orders` and `ledger` models can ship, and the Fennick release branch is frozen. On-call: don't retry pushes — that extends the lockout. Unseal the vault first, then rerun migration 0147. The vault's recovery passphrase is recorded directly below:

strongbox words: fenwyn-lamix-novael-holeth-sorix-druael-lamwyn

Changed defaults in Splitfork, our assignment service. Bucketing now uses sticky hashing per account instead of per session, and the holdout slice grew from 2% to 5%. Callers relying on session-level reassignment must opt in explicitly. Review the diff against the new baseline; the updated default configuration is listed below.

config for tagep-kajof:
[casir]
port = 6379
region = south-1
host = casir.paliqdyn.example
team = tamax
timeout_ms = 250
retries = 2

The pilot deployment of our Ledgerline shelf-analytics suite across twelve Merrowfield stores concluded on schedule. Stock-out detection accuracy met contract thresholds, and store managers reported reduced manual audit time. Merrowfield has signaled interest in a wider rollout pending commercial terms. Integration costs ran slightly above estimate due to legacy point-of-sale systems, but remained within the approved envelope. A confidential note on the business plans tied to this pilot appears immediately below.

confidential, kagep-kahof: Druokax Systems plans to lower the Ulaath list price by 53 percent in March.